Aircrew and bomb damage

Description

Three photographs mounted on a page.
Top: Eight aircrew in battledress, seven standing in a line by the open rear door of a Lancaster and one seated on the tailplane. It is captioned: 'Crew of PA 320 AY-S'.
Bottom left: Vertical aerial photograph showing roads and gutted buildings in a town or city.
Bottom right: Oblique aerial photograph showing roads and bomb damaged and gutted buildings in a town or city.
Both are captioned: 'Bomb damage at Dusseldorf [sic]'.
